Civic engagement Sample Letter for Advocation of Legislation: A well-crafted sample letter for advocating legislation in Massachusetts plays a crucial role in conveying concerns, suggestions, and recommendations to elected officials. Such letters generally follow a specific structure that includes the following key elements: 1. Opening paragraph: This section serves as an introduction, expressing gratitude to the recipient for their public service and highlighting the specific legislation or issue being addressed. It should state the purpose of the letter, the objective of advocacy, and the relevant bill or policy. 2. Personal background and story: In this segment, the writer can emphasize their personal connection to the issue, sharing personal experiences, anecdotes, research, or data to support their argument. Demonstrating the impact of the legislation on individuals or communities often adds persuasive strength to the letter. 3. Primary concerns: The body of the letter should outline the main concerns surrounding the legislation. It is essential to provide compelling evidence and statistics to substantiate these concerns, showcasing a thorough understanding of the issue at hand. 4. Suggested solutions: After presenting concerns, the writer should offer potential solutions or recommendations to address the issue. It is crucial to propose actionable and realistic steps that policymakers can take to achieve the desired change. 5. Call to action: Conclude the letter by reiterating the requested action, whether it involves supporting or opposing legislation, suggesting amendments or new bills. Encourage the recipient to take a stand, urging them to prioritize the interests of their constituents. Types of Massachusetts Sample Letters for Advocation of Legislation: 1. Environmental Advocacy Letters: These letters focus on environmental concerns, urging lawmakers to support or initiate legislation aimed at conserving natural resources, combating climate change, promoting renewable energy, or addressing pollution and waste management. 2. Education Advocacy Letters: These letters revolve around the improvement of Massachusetts' educational system, emphasizing the need for policies that promote equitable access to quality education, increased funding for public schools, or reforms in curriculum and teacher evaluation. 3. Healthcare Advocacy Letters: This category of letters concentrates on healthcare reforms, advocating for comprehensive healthcare coverage, affordable healthcare options, improved mental health services, or specific disease-related legislation. 4. Criminal Justice Advocacy Letters: Addressing criminal justice concerns, these letters advocate for criminal justice reform, fair sentencing practices, alternatives to incarceration, juvenile justice reform, or improving conditions within the justice system. Keep it brief: Letters should never be longer than one page, and should be limited to one issue. Legislative aides read many letters on many issues in a day, so your letter should be as concise as possible.

Here are some important tips for your letter:Use letterhead.Verify the correct spelling of the legislator's name.Verify the correct title to use when addressing the legislator.Keep it short (one page maximum).Identify the issue.If the issue is a particular bill, verify the full name and bill number.More items...

State your subject clearly in the email subject line or first sentence of the letter. Stick to just one issue in the letter. Identify yourself as a constituent. State your views, support them with your expert knowledge and, when appropriate, cite the bill number of relevant legislation (e.g., H.R.
